vintage hand-painted Mexican folk art wood box created by artist Salvador Corona.
characterized by colorful scenes of dancers, riders, and pastoral landscapes painted on a white background.
These decorative tabletop trunks were often produced by Corona in the mid-20th century, specifically between the 1930s and 1940s
